Osaka is Japan’s second-largest metropolitan area and a major economic powerhouse. Located in the Kansai region, it’s a designated city with a population of over 2.8 million, forming the core of a wider 19 million+ inhabitant urban area. Historically a vital port and former imperial capital, Osaka evolved into a key industrial center and remains a significant financial hub today, home to the Osaka Exchange and corporate headquarters like Panasonic and Sharp.
Beyond its economic strength, Osaka is known for its vibrant, down-to-earth atmosphere – often considered more approachable than Tokyo. It’s a surprisingly multicultural city with a strong local identity, boasting a thriving food scene and a robust academic presence with leading universities like Osaka University. Expect a fast pace, excellent connectivity, and a blend of traditional and modern influences.
